Job Summary:

This position offers an exciting opportunity to drive comprehensive marketing and creative operations for a dynamic educational benefits program. The role combines strategic project management with hands-on creative execution, requiring someone who can seamlessly navigate between auditing existing materials, coordinating cross-functional stakeholders, and producing compelling visual content. You will serve as the central hub for all program collateral, ensuring consistency, accuracy, and visual appeal across multiple platforms including digital sites, video content, internal wikis, and physical merchandise. This role demands a versatile professional who can manage complex workflows while maintaining creative excellence, working with both internal teams and external agencies to bring projects from concept to completion.

Responsibilities:

• Audit all existing program collateral including websites, instructional videos, wiki content, and physical merchandise
• Create and maintain master tracking documents for all assets requiring updates
• Coordinate with internal stakeholders to gather requirements and implement updates across all touchpoints
• Manage version control and approval workflows for all materials
• Update training and onboarding materials to reflect current program information
• Refresh instructional tutorial videos including graphics, lower thirds, and end cards
• Redesign wiki content templates and visual elements for improved user experience
• Update physical merchandise designs and coordinate production
• Build comprehensive template library including posters, one-sheets, and success story templates
• Create modular design system for future collateral needs and document usage guidelines
• Coordinate with facilities for shoot locations and logistics planning
• Source and schedule employee participants for video and photo casting
• Manage participant releases and documentation for all content featuring employees
• Coordinate with external agencies on shoot execution and deliverables
• Support additional marketing initiatives and projects as priorities emerge
• Provide project management and creative execution support across evolving program needs

Skills:

• Project management capabilities with proven ability to manage multiple concurrent workstreams
• Creative proficiency and design sensibility
• Strong organizational skills and attention to detail
• Experience managing creative projects and agency relationships
• Proficiency with creative tools such as Adobe Express
• Excellent communication and stakeholder management abilities
• Ability to work independently with minimal supervision
• Video production and editing knowledge
• Template development and design system creation
• Documentation and process management

Experience:

• 3 years of experience in marketing project management or creative production
• Demonstrated experience balancing project management responsibilities with creative execution
• Track record of managing creative assets and maintaining brand consistency across multiple channels
